Northwest Natural Yard Days (NNYD) encourages residents of King County and surrounding areas to practice natural yard care by offering discounts on natural yard care product sales in the spring each year.

This year, 64 retail locations offer discounts on natural yard care products: non-polluting mulch mowers (external) , grasscycling (PDF, 337 K), least toxic pest and weed control, and water conserving tools.

Northwest Natural Yard Days endorses the regional five steps of natural yard care:

  1. Build healthy soil
  2. Plant right for your site
  3. Practice smart watering
  4. Think twice before using pesticides
  5. Practice natural lawn care
